Birth
Roald Amundsen was born in Norway. -
Death of Father
Roald's father, Jens Amundsen, was 65 and died because of extreme illness. Roald was only 14. -
Inspiration
Roald's parents wanted him to study medicine but he was inspired by the crossing of Greenland so Roald wanted to become an explorer. -
Death of Mother
Hanna Sahlqvist (Roald's mother) dies at the age of 56. Since his parents were dead, He was free to become an explorer. -

First Voyage
Roald Amundsen sets sail on his first voyage, on the Belgian Antartic Expedition. This becomes his first expedition, in Antartica. Roald and the rest of the crew arrive back to Belguim with their expedition being a success. But they were lucky to have it that way because the expedition was poorly prepared. There was not enough clothes and food for everyone and their ship to go. -

Roald's Death
Roald disappears while flying on a rescue mission, trying to rescue members of a crash that were returning from the North Pole. No real evidence was found on how he really died.
